B. AskUserQuestion → request_user_input Mapping
GSD workflows use AskUserQuestion (Claude Code syntax). Translate to Codex request_user_input:
Parameter mapping:
header→headerquestion→question- Options formatted as
"Label" — description→{label: "Label", description: "description"} - Generate
idfrom header: lowercase, replace spaces with underscores
Batched calls:
AskUserQuestion([q1, q2])→ singlerequest_user_inputwith multiple entries inquestions[]
Multi-select workaround:
- Codex has no
multiSelect. Use sequential single-selects, or present a numbered freeform list asking the user to enter comma-separated numbers.
Execute mode fallback:
- When
request_user_inputis rejected (Execute mode), present a plain-text numbered list and pick a reasonable default.
C. Task() → spawn_agent Mapping
GSD workflows use Task(...) (Claude Code syntax). Translate to Codex collaboration tools:
Direct mapping:
Task(subagent_type="X", prompt="Y")→spawn_agent(agent_type="X", message="Y")Task(model="...")→ omit.spawn_agenthas no inlinemodelparameter;
GSD embeds the resolved per-agent model directly into each agent's .toml at install time so model_overrides from .planning/config.json and ~/.gsd/defaults.json are honored automatically by Codex's agent router.
fork_context: falseby default — GSD agents load their own context via<files_to_read>blocks
Spawn restriction:
- Codex restricts
spawn_agentto cases where the user has explicitly
requested sub-agents. When automatic spawning is not permitted, do the work inline in the current agent rather than attempting to force a spawn.
Parallel fan-out:
- Spawn multiple agents → collect agent IDs →
wait(ids)for all to complete
Result parsing:
- Look for structured markers in agent output:
CHECKPOINT,PLAN COMPLETE,SUMMARY, etc. close_agent(id)after collecting results from each agent

<objective> Single-terminal command center for managing a milestone. Shows a dashboard of all phases with visual status indicators, recommends optimal next actions, and dispatches work — discuss runs inline, plan/execute run as background agents.
Designed for power users who want to parallelize work across phases from one terminal: discuss a phase while another plans or executes in the background.
Creates/Updates:
- No files created directly — dispatches to existing GSD commands via Skill() and background Task agents.
- Reads
.planning/STATE.md,.planning/ROADMAP.md, phase directories for status.
After: User exits when done managing, or all phases complete and milestone lifecycle is suggested. </objective>
